Output 45f3e73880e42a7cdcdfd7d31297c2df8671f81344d14b6077bdeb5d3057c31e:1

value
9500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1f5a377eb0ffa5955baef37ea0dbd11928c014e OP_EQUAL
address
3NHnDyHEs4iRyhgD69gag3uex8p1ApzU9T
transaction
45f3e73880e42a7cdcdfd7d31297c2df8671f81344d14b6077bdeb5d3057c31e
spent
true